Flash storage
Any type of data repository or storage system that uses flash memory. Does not need a PSU. Fast but expensive, small, limited amount of writes and erases.

Cloud storage
Based on the internet, can be accessed anywhere on any device with an internet connection. Have to pay to get more storage on most.

Hard Disk Drive
Mechanical due to disk and read/write head inside, can spin up to 7,200RPM. Cheap, non-volatile. Not that fast, easy to break (dropping it), use power to read/write.

Optical drives
Uses laser light or electromagnetic waves within or near the visible light spectrum to read/write data. Great for archiving, once written cannot be overwritten. Require a specific drive to use (becoming obsolete), not a lot of storage
